Abstract: Background - Validity threats should be considered and … Webb25 sep. 2024 · Positivism is an approach that views the world as ‘out there’ waiting be observed and analysed by the researcher. Theories that are built on positivism see the world ‘as it is’ and base their assumptions upon analysing physical elements such as states and international organisations, which they can account for and ascribe values to.

The Aztec God Huitzilopochtli encouraged the people to move often, and endure many hardships. Webb22 juli 2024 · Pragmatism supports mixed research methods to address the problem statement. It allows a researcher to integrate the strengths of qualitative and quantitative research within a study. WebbPhase 1: The Researcher as a Multicultural Subject Phase 2: Philosophical Assumptions and Interpretive Frameworks Phase 3: Research Strategies and Approaches Phase 4: … WebbThe epistemology of a worldview is what it has to say on how we can know things, or in other words, be justified in believing things, or simply believe true things that are reliable. The Ethics of a worldview are the statements that follow about what is good or right or just or other evaluative truths in it (or pseudo-truths like expressive rules).
